• 操作系统面试题(十):页式内存管理中的块表和多级页表

    时间:2024-04-07 19:05:58

    文章目录块表【1】块表【2】多级页表【3】总结块表在页式内存管理中有2个重要的问题:虚拟地址到物理地址的转换要快当虚拟空间很大时,相应的页表也会变得很大为了解决这两个问题,引入了块表和多级页表块表用于解决地址转换速度问题多级页表用于解决页表过大,资源浪费问题【1】块表块表可以直接理解为页式内存管理的...

  • 操作系统【三】内存管理基础+连续内存分配

    时间:2024-04-07 14:29:29

    内存的基础知识内存分为按字节编址(8位)和字编制(不同计算机不一样,64位计算机就是64位,即8个字节)相对地址=逻辑地址 绝对地址=物理地址从逻辑地址到物理地址的转换由装入解决。装入的三种方式绝对装入:在编译时知道程序放在内存中的哪个位置,编译程序将产生绝对地址的目标代码。灵活性很低,只适用于单道...

  • 操作系统页式存储管理16进制转换

    时间:2024-04-07 14:29:05

    转载:http://blog.csdn.net/sinat_33442459/article/details/71123035十六进制逻辑地址转物理地址一分页存储管理系统中逻辑地址长度为16位,页面大小为4KB字节,现有一逻辑地址为2F6AH,且第0,1,2,页依次存放在物理块5,10,11中,...

  • 操作系统课程总结(存储器管理)

    时间:2024-04-07 14:26:40

    之前忘了发出来的一篇。[4]存储器管理存储器层次结构存储器描述寄存器在CPU内,具有与其相同的速度,主要用于存储处理机运行时的数据高速缓存分为多级缓存,L1 cahce速度最快,因内置而容量不能太大,L2 cache速度差一些,但容量大,对性能起主要影响作用主存即内存,早期的内存由磁芯构成,现在的内...

  • 操作系统物理内存管理:连续和非连续

    时间:2024-04-07 14:25:46

    物理内存管理:连续内存分配地址空间定义物理地址空间:硬件支持的地址空间起始地址0,直到 MAXsys逻辑地址空间:在 CPU 运行的进程看到的地址起始地址0,直到 MAXprog地址生成时机和限制编译时假设起始地址已知如果起始地址改变,必须重新编译加载时如编译时起始位置未知,编译器需生成可重定位的代...

  • 操作系统内存管理--简单 页式 段式 段页式

    时间:2024-04-07 14:21:14

    分享一下我老师大神的人工智能教程!零基础,通俗易懂!http://blog.csdn.net/jiangjunshow也欢迎大家转载本篇文章。分享知识,造福人民,实现我们中华民族伟大复兴!                一、内存管理的目的和功能内存一直是计算机系统中宝贵而又紧俏的资源,内存能否被有效...

  • 《现代操作系统(中文第三版)》课后习题——第五章 输入/输出

    时间:2024-04-07 14:19:14

    第五章 输入/输出1.芯片技术的进展已经使得将整个控制器包括所有总线访问逻辑放在一个便宜的芯片上成为可能。这对于图1-5的模型具有什么影响?答:(题目有问题,应该是图1-6)在此图中,一个控制器有两个设备。单个控制器可以有多个设备就无需每个设备都有一个控制器。如果控制器变得几乎是自由的,那么只需把控...

  • 操作系统概念第八章部分作业题答案

    时间:2024-04-07 14:18:49

    题目一:试说明内部碎片和外部碎片之间的差别解答:内部碎片是指进程所分配的内存可能比进程所需要的大外部碎片是指由于进程的大小不一导致内存被分成小片段且不连续,造成空间浪费。题目二:考虑一个页表在内存中的内存分页系统:(1)如果内存访问的时间为 200ns,试问访问页表中的一个数据需要多长时间?(2)如...

  • 操作系统概念第八章

    时间:2024-04-07 14:16:12

    内存管理题目一题目二题目三题目四题目一试说明内部碎片和外部碎片之间的差别。解:内部碎片是在在某一区域或某一页中,没有被占据其位置的进程所使用的区域。直到进程结束,释放该页或该区域,这个空间才可以重新被系统所利用。外部碎片是由进程的不连续分配所产生的。题目二考虑一个页表在内存中的内存分页系统:(1)如...

  • 现代操作系统笔记——第五章输入输出

    时间:2024-04-07 14:12:05

    第五章输入输出(IO)IO设备分为两类:块设备把信息存储在固定大小的块中,每个块都有自己的地址,所有传输以一个或多个完整的块为单位,基本特征时每个块能独立于其它的块而读写。如磁盘字符设备以字符为单位发送或接收一个字符流,而不考虑任何块结构,不可寻址也没有任何寻道操作,如打印机、网络接口、鼠标等   ...

  • 深入理解操作系统——处理器体系结构笔记

    时间:2024-04-07 13:55:57

    文章目录处理器体系结构Y86-64指令集体系结构程序员可见状态Y86-64指令指令编码Y86-64 异常逻辑设计和硬件控制语言HCL逻辑门组合电路和HCL布尔表达式字级的组合电路和HCL整数表达式存储器和时钟Y86-64的顺序实现流水线的通用原理流水线的局限性带反馈的流水线系统处理器体系结构处理器必...

  • Ubuntu18.04操作系统sudo apt-get update报错

    时间:2024-04-07 09:39:50

    Ubuntu18.04操作系统sudo apt-get update报错E: 部分索引文件下载失败。如果忽略它们,那将转而使用旧的索引文件。(最简单的解决办法)当sudo apt-get update下载时,因为有‘墙’的原因。容易下载中断,或者下不完整。Ubuntu自带修改源的图形操作界面。1.进...

  • SQLServer在E盘创建数据库,出现尝试打开或创建物理文件 REATE FILE 遇到操作系统错误(拒绝访问)的问题

    时间:2024-04-07 09:34:47

    问题:尝试打开或创建物理文件 REATE FILE 遇到操作系统错误 5(拒绝访问)原因:刚开始还以为是文件名不能有中文,后来又以为是有些服务没有开启,结果在网上搜罗了一圈,有些说是有的服务没有开启,有些说权限的问题,找了好几个都没有搞定;我就试了试分别在C盘、D盘、E盘创建数据库:1、C盘:如果用...

  • 【梳理】简明操作系统原理 第九章 死锁与活锁(内附文档高清截图)

    时间:2024-04-06 22:05:14

    参考教材:Operating Systems: Three Easy PiecesRemzi H. Arpaci-Dusseau and Andrea C. Arpaci-Dusseau在线阅读:http://pages.cs.wisc.edu/~remzi/OSTEP/University of ...

  • 深入理解计算机操作系统——12章:多进程,IO多路复用

    时间:2024-04-06 20:44:31

    三种并行的应用程序:1. 基于进程的并发编程:2. 基于IO多路复用的并发:3. 基于线程的并发编程:12.1 基于进程的并发编程进程的优劣:(1)进程间共享文件表,但不共享用户地址空间,拥有独立的地址空间,这样一个进程不会不小心将另一个进程的虚拟存储器给覆盖了。(2)独立的地址空间使得进程间通信很...

  • 1、了解计算机与操作系统发展阶段 2、选择一个具体的操作系统,结合计算机与操作系统的发展阶段,详细了解其渊源、发展过程、趋势,整理成简洁美观的图文博客发布。 Windows Mac os x Unix Linux Android 等。

    时间:2024-04-06 20:29:18

    1.了解计算机与操作系统发展阶段操作系统并不是与计算机硬件一起诞生的,它是在人们使用计算机的过程中,为了满足两大需求:提高资源利用率、增强计算机系统性能,伴随着计算机技术本身及其应用的日益发展,而逐步地形成和完善起来的。1946年第一台计算机诞生--20世纪50年代中期,还未出现操作系统,计算机工作...

  • 计算机操作系统处理机调度读后感—–关于进程概念的剖析。从RING3到RING0(32位操作系统)

    时间:2024-04-06 19:59:26

    计算机操作系统处理机调度读后感:笔者在看操作系统西安电子科技大学那本书的时候,初次感觉本科教的不会太难,所以没有认真的看,但是随后这本书讲的刷新了我的世界观。这本书居然是ring0级别的,这时不禁吐槽一下。。如果没调试过程序,没接触过ring0的同学,这本书就和马原一样。全背完还不知道学了啥。由于笔...

  • 认识计算机操作系统(day01)

    时间:2024-04-06 19:54:01

    一、计算机的框架什么是操作系统?(汽车)加油系统 油门 用户跟加油子系统交互的窗口。(接口)方向系统 方向盘 用户跟方向系统的交互接口。导航系统。。。汽车的操作系统有很多的子系统来完成。这些子系统互相协调工作,达到用户的目的。操作简练、效率高、安全性比较高...。接口 多个子系统 ...

  • poweroff---关闭计算机操作系统并且切断系统电源。

    时间:2024-04-06 19:34:43

    poweroff命令用来关闭计算机操作系统并且切断系统电源。语法poweroff(选项)选项-n:关闭操作系统时不执行sync操作;-w:不真正关闭操作系统,仅在日志文件“/var/log/wtmp”中;-d:关闭操作系统时,不将操作写入日志文件“/var/log/wtmp”中添加相应的记录;-f:...

  • CentOS、Ubuntu、Debian等操作系统的区别

    时间:2024-04-06 17:07:11

    前言赶着双十一,入手了一台阿里云服务器ECS突发性能T6。**的时候需要选择一个操作系统,那么这些操作系统都有什么区别呢,let our see see。区别1. Windows适合asp、SqlServer2. LinuxLinux有非常多的发行版本,从性质上划分,大体分为由商业公司维护的商业版本...